The AIA season has come to a close, and nine AIA competitors averaged 11 or more boards per game, helping their teams gain possession on missed shots.
<strong>Abbigail Coquitt</strong>, a sophomore from 1A’s Mayer, was the leader with 18.4 boards on average. She was just one of two sophomores of the nine. In the lead was the seniors, which had four players of the nine. <strong>[player_tooltip player_id="135742" first="Dominique" last="Acosta"]</strong> of Nogales was the top senior, averaging 13.3 per game. She was one of the 4 5A players on the list, which comprised the most of any conference.
